Template:InfoCharacter Mrs. Sinclair was Greg's math teacher in his third grade who taught her class tricks to make it easy for them to remember tables. Whenever Greg faces a difficulty he uses the trick, but it slowed him down in his work. Her trick was to sing this song:

'Eight times four is thirty two

Thirty-two, thirty-two

Eight times four is thirty-two

And now you know it's true!' (To the tune of "Mary had a Little Lamb")

Trivia

She only appeared in Diary of a Wimpy Kid: Cabin Fever .
